The parsonage is nearby, plus there is also the railway station. And the Bronte Falls (a waterfall, footbridge and "Charlotte's Chair") is within walking distance of Haworth. Not to mention "Top Withens" farm, said to be the inspiration for "Wuthering Heights". (This is mentioned on page 34 of "A Guide To Historic Haworth And The Brontes" by Mark Ward with Ann Dinsdale and Robert Swindells).
